The bets that sports bettors primarily choose to place at both web-based and land-based bookmakers are called money line bets. In this type of bet, the bettor simply picks the team that will come out on top at the end of the game. Unlike some other betting scenarios, a bettor does not have to worry about other factors, such as whether the winning team will cover a point spread. With money line betting, all that matters is that the selected team wins.

A thorough understanding of how the Money Line works will give players an edge. A Money Line bet is a simple bet. You pick the winner of the contest to win, and if they do, you get paid. Great Introduction for Beginners

Money line betting is a great way to introduce someone to the world of sports betting. In this most basic form of betting, a person simply predicts which of two teams will win a game. In the moneyline world, there are no point spreads to mess around with and no need to understand what it means when a team is favored by 7 or 8 points. If you want to bet on basketball, for example, why not just pick the winner straight up?

Unlike other forms of betting, such as point spread betting or over/under betting, money line betting focuses solely on which team will win the game. This makes it an attractive entry point for people who find the mechanics of sports betting intimidating.

Moneyline betting is a tactic used to bet on the straight up winner of a game. It does not involve point spreads. When you place a Money Line bet, you are placing a wager directly on the team you think will win. Payouts are directly related to each team's probability of winning. The less likely a team is to win, the higher the odds you will receive when betting on that team. Conversely, if you bet on a team that is more likely to win, you will get lower odds - and therefore a lower payout - on that bet.
